Output 966ba85ee5c6186c036e6cb12672df08d4a43cac0730ab18fd9334122352872d:80

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5192198e6f164b870f6b22efc5f74b5d3ab26ec0b7a3b5e79cae9a7d43f0f03
address
bc1p65vjrx8x79jtsu8kkgh0chm5khf6kfhvpdarkhneet5604plpupsu2xpzl
transaction
966ba85ee5c6186c036e6cb12672df08d4a43cac0730ab18fd9334122352872d
spent
true